CLEARTOX: Development of an innovative haemodialysis method to improve dialytic clearance of protein-bound uraemic toxins

Hospices Civils De Lyon1 个研究点 分布在 1 个国家目标入组 12 人开始时间: 2024年11月12日最近更新:

主要终点
Clearance of p-Cresyl sulfate during hemodialysis. Dialysis clearance is defined as follows: Clairance = Qd X (C dialysate/C arterial) Calculated over 240 minutes with Qd corresponding to dialysate flow rate, C dialysate uremic toxin concentration in dialysate, C arterial uremic toxin concentration in blood taken from the arterial port of the dialyzer.

研究概览

简要总结

Compare the clearance of p-cresyl sulfate during dialysis (from H0 to H4) between a hemodialysis session with infusion of a medium-chain fatty acid emulsion (Medialipide®) and a hemodialysis session with infusion of saline.

入选标准

  • Age ≥18 years
  • On hemodialysis at a frequency of 3 4-hour sessions per week, for at least 3 months
  • For patients of childbearing potential, highly effective contraception (e.g. total sexual abstinence, combined hormonal contraception, bilateral tubal obstruction, etc.) is required for the entire duration of treatment. A blood pregnancy test (beta-HCG) will be performed at inclusion.
  • Patient affiliated to a social security scheme
  • Free, informed and written consent signed by the patient

排除标准

  • Residual diuresis > 100 mL per day
  • Patients with unstable metabolic conditions (e.g. severe post-traumatic syndrome, coma of unknown origin)
  • Patients in the acute phase of myocardial infarction or stroke
  • Pregnant or breastfeeding
  • Patients with uncorrected disturbances of fluid and electrolyte balance, such as hypokalemia and hypotonic dehydration
  • Patients with decompensated heart failure
  • patients with acute pulmonary edema
  • Subject having participated in another interventional research study in the 30 days prior to inclusion in the study or still within 5 half-lives of the experimental product of a previous interventional research study.
  • Uncontrolled hypertension > 180/115 mmHg
  • Perdialytic hypotension requiring vascular filling > 100 mL during the last 3 sessions
  • Patient already on parenteral nutrition
  • Patients with sepsis < 1 month
  • Patient already on antivitamin K (or prescribed less than one month prior to inclusion)
  • Patient with heparin allergy or requiring hemodialysis without anticoagulant (recent hemorrhage)
  • Patients allergic to egg, soy or peanut proteins or to any of the active ingredients or excipients (glycerol, egg phospholipids for injection, a-tocopherol, sodium oleate (for pH adjustment), water for injection) of Médialipide®
  • Patients with severe hyperlipidemia or severe lipid metabolism disorders characterized by hypertriglyceridemia > 3 mmol/l
  • Patients on non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s
  • Patients under legal protection
  • Persons incapable of expressing their consent
  • Persons deprived of their liberty and emergency situations.
  • Patient with severe liver failure or cholestasis
  • Patient with known severe coagulopathy
  • Patient with acute thromboembolic events
  • Patient with fat embolism
  • Patient with an aggravating bleeding diathesis
  • Patient with uncompensated metabolic acidosis
  • Patient with an unstable circulatory state threatening the vital prognosis (collapse and shock)

次要结局

  • The fraction of p-CS reduction during the hemodialysis session. The reduction fraction (RF) will be calculated according to the formula: RF (%) = ( Concentration (t=0 min) - Concentration (t=240 min ))/Concentration (t= 0 min)
  • Clearance and reduction fraction (over 240 minutes) of other protein-bound uremic toxins during the hemodialysis session: indoxyl sulfate, hippuric acid, p-cresyl glucuronide, 3-indole acetic acid, uric acid and 3-carboxy-4-methyl-5propyl-furanpro-pionic acid.
  • Tolerance: % of patients with at least one of the following adverse events: nausea, vomiting or headache during the session.
  • Safety: % of patients with one of the following events: triglyceridemia > 4 g/L or 4.6 mmol/L at the end of the session, alteration in liver balance (ALT, ASAT, gamma GT, PAL, free and conjugated bilirubin) or significant hemolysis during follow-up.
  • Comparison of plasma concentration of medium-chain fatty acids (octanoate and decanoate) between start and end of infusion.
